External Lecturer in Management Accounting and Control at the Department of Management, Aarhus BSS



Job description

A position as External Lecturer (part-time) in Management Accounting and Control at the Department of Management, Aarhus BSS, Aarhus University, is available from 1 December 2025 or as soon as possible thereafter.

The position is a three-year appointment, and the specific number of working hours as well as teaching assignments will be agreed upon prior to each semester.

Teaching and supervision can be conducted in both Danish and English, and applications written in Danish are also welcome.

Job description


The position includes supervision and teaching within the broader area of management accounting and control, with specialization in topics and related theories in the areas of cost management, performance measurement and management, planning and budgeting, and ERP/AIS systems.

Applicants are therefore expected to have solid knowledge and experience within management accounting and control, with particular emphasis on the above-mentioned topics.

An educational background in management accounting and control or related fields is a requirement, and practical experience with applications of related topics and theories as well as experience in academic supervision is important.
Applicants must possess both strong theoretical knowledge and practical experience within the relevant subject areas.

Who we are


The Department of Management is one of six departments at Aarhus BSS, one of the five faculties at Aarhus University.

Aarhus BSS brings together the core fields of business and social sciences to reflect the close relationship between society and the business community.

Aarhus University is ranked among the world’s top 100 universities, and Aarhus BSS as well as the Department of Management hold the prestigious AACSB, AMBA and EQUIS accreditations—the latter specifically covering the faculty’s core business activities.
The department offers an international and multicultural research and teaching environment, consisting of both Danish and international researchers and PhD students.

We employ more than 160 academic staff members, including faculty, PhD students, and affiliated researchers, and cover a broad range of management disciplines.
We are committed to producing high-quality research, publishing in leading academic journals, and presenting our work at recognized conferences.

We also host a continuous exchange of international scholars affiliated with the department for both short- and long-term periods.

Qualifications


Employment as a part-time lecturer requires qualifications at Master's degree level as well as additional high-level qualifications, special theses, knowledge or practical experience gained through employment in the professional field related to the academic specialisation in question.

Teaching qualifications form part of the assessment basis.
